Interface
The
Interfaces
tab provides a listing of all the physical and logical interfaces that are configured on the selected device. The Management interface is the Interface IP used to manage the device in Network Configuration Manager. Management Interfaces can be changed from this tab.
From this tab (
Interfaces
) within the Configuration tab, you can Add, Delete, or select another Interface to become the Managing Interface.
You
cannot
add or delete an Interface anywhere but within a Workspace.
